About

Allvet Financial serves individual clients, with a client base that does not emphasize high-net-worth households, and provides discretionary asset management together with ongoing financial planning and consulting. Offerings include portfolio oversight using mutual funds and exchange-traded funds and integrated student loan repayment planning as part of comprehensive financial plans.

The firm generally follows passive, buy-and-hold strategies informed by modern portfolio theory and uses discretionary trading authority to implement asset allocation, rebalancing, and tax-loss harvesting where appropriate. Account reviews are performed at least annually (and more frequently as market conditions dictate), and the firm emphasizes long-term planning and discourages short-term market timing.

What sets the firm apart is its practitioner-oriented niche: leadership and staff have veterinary backgrounds and hold certifications related to student loan advising and financial counseling, which shapes a focus on veterinary professionals and student loan issues. The firm manages a relatively modest asset base across a larger roster of individual clients, offers recurring planning subscriptions, and discloses outside student loan consulting activities that are mitigated through policies and fiduciary obligations.

Meredith Jones is a financial advisor at Allvet Financial with a Series 65 designation and three years of industry experience. She previously worked at Student Loan Planner, SLP Wealth, and Vincere Wealth Management, among other roles. Outside of her advisory duties, she operates Dr. Meredith Jones, LLC, where she performs speaking engagements, consulting, and content creation.
